Tree Disassembling And Tree Felling

The tree surgeons with whom we work are specialists in the precise taking down of large, difficult and hazardous trees inside cramped areas. They are experienced in removing trees from difficult locations and can manoeuvre through tight spaces.

A range of tree removal solutions may be utilised including directional felling, sectional dismantling, the use of cranes or specialist winch operations. It all depends on the available space as to which method they will use.

Tree Felling

This is where the tree is cut from the base and then it falls to the ground in a controlled fashion. This is only done in areas that are safe from any potential damage to property or others. This technique is not always possible for large trees, as it takes a lot of space for them to fall.

Tree Dismantling

It is used when space is restricted. All debris must be directed down so as to not cause any property damage or injury to others. It is difficult to dismantle trees in sections. Starting at the top of the tree, sections are cut and then lowered to safety and under control using lowering ropes/slings and sometimes a crane.

The tree surgeons that we work with are skilled at navigating tight spaces. They use the latest rigging techniques for the safe removal of trees from your garden.

To stop it from falling in the opposite direction, they use ropes and/or slings.

Stump Grinding And Stump Removal

No matter whether your tree has been felled due to storm damage or infection, it’s not easy to remove the old stump.

Professional tree surgeons are the best people to help you remove the old stumps from your property, as they have all the necessary tools to make it a simple and straightforward task.

Stump extraction involves the removal or a reduction of the tree stump to a certain depth. It is typically between 150mm and 300mm. Any lateral roots belonging to the tree are also removed.

The stump grinder is used to remove the stump, while the surrounding garden remains unharmed. A stump grinder is piece of equipment with carbine-tipped teeth attached on a large rotating wheel. The teeth are placed at different angles around the wheel.

To leave minimal evidence of the stump removal work, the remaining hole is filled with soil and/or grinding waste.

Tree Protection Orders (TPO's) & Tree Conservation Orders

Throughout the UK a number of trees are protected. Trees with a trunk size larger than 75mm at a trunk height of 1.5 metres are usually contained in the complete conservation area cover. Trees will have to be inspected to find out if they are susceptible to a Tree Preservation Order (TPO) or if the tree(s) are in a Conservation Area by meeting with your local area authority before scheduling any type of project. Crown Reshaping And Reduction

Is an operation which leads to a general reduction in the spread and/or height of the crown of your tree by means of a general pruning of branches and/or twigs, whilst maintaining the basic form of your tree’s crown.
